ATP Marseille: Dennis Novak failed in the first round
Dennis Novak left the first round of the ATP Tour 250 tournament in Marseille. Austria's number two lost 6: 7 (3) and 3: 6 to Belarusian Egor Gerasimov.

Both players had fought their way through the qualification into the main field of the 250 event, so that at least brought twelve points to the safe side for the ATP world rankings. From Novak's point of view, it shouldn't be enough: after 83 minutes, Gerasimov, who had defeated Casper Ruud in round one at the Australian Open, went 7: 6 (3) and 6: 3 as the winner. Next Opponents are now waiting with David Goffin number three of the tournament.
Both players will be involved in the Davis Cup on March 6th and 7th, each as number one in their country: Absent from Dominic Thiem , Novak leads the Austrian selection in Premstätten against Uruguay, Gerasimov plays with Belarus in Düsseldorf against Germany.
